1. One-Pan Chicken and Vegetables

This recipe is not only quick to prepare but also minimizes cleanup. In just about 30 minutes, you can have a flavorful and nutritious meal ready.

Ingredients:

  • 4 chicken thighs (bone-in or boneless)
  • 2 cups of mixed vegetables (carrots, bell peppers, and zucchini)
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. In a large bowl, combine the chicken thighs, mixed vegetables, olive oil, garlic powder, paprika, salt, and pepper. Mix well to ensure the chicken and vegetables are evenly coated.
  3. Spread the mixture on a baking sheet and roast for 25-30 minutes, or until the chicken is fully cooked and the vegetables are tender.
  4. Serve hot and enjoy your one-pan wonder!

2. Creamy Chicken Alfredo Pasta

Pasta lovers rejoice! This creamy chicken Alfredo is a hearty dish that’s sure to please the whole family.

Ingredients:

  • 2 chicken breasts, sliced
  • 8 oz fettuccine pasta
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Fresh parsley for garnish

Instructions:

  1. Cook the fettuccine pasta according to package instructions; drain and set aside.
  2. In a skillet, melt the butter over medium heat. Add the sliced chicken breasts and season with salt and pepper. Cook until browned and cooked through, about 6-8 minutes.
  3. Lower the heat, then stir in the heavy cream and Parmesan cheese. Mix until the sauce thickens slightly.
  4. Add the cooked pasta to the skillet, tossing to combine. Garnish with fresh parsley before serving.

1. Chicken and Rice Casserole

This dish is simple to prepare and offers a one-dish solution for supper, combining protein and carbs in a delicious way.

Ingredients:

Ingredient Measurement
Cooked chicken, shredded 2 cups
White rice, uncooked 1 cup
Chicken broth 2 cups
Cream of mushroom soup 1 can (10.5 oz)
Mixed vegetables (peas and carrots) 1 cup
Shredded cheese (optional) 1 cup

Instructions:

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. In a large mixing bowl, combine the cooked chicken, uncooked rice, chicken broth, cream of mushroom soup, and mixed vegetables.
  3. Pour the mixture into a greased casserole dish and cover with foil.
  4. Bake for 45 minutes, then remove the foil and sprinkle cheese on top, if desired. Bake for another 15 minutes or until the rice is tender and the cheese is melted.

2. Cheesy Chicken Broccoli Casserole

This casserole is a fantastic way to sneak in some vegetables with everyone’s favorite ingredient: cheese!

Ingredients:

Ingredient Measurement
Cooked chicken, diced 2 cups
Broccoli florets 2 cups (fresh or frozen)
Cheddar cheese, shredded 1 ½ cups
Mayonnaise ½ cup
Breadcrumbs (for topping) ½ cup

Instructions:

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. In a large bowl, combine the diced chicken, broccoli florets, mayonnaise, and 1 cup of shredded cheese. Mix until well-combined.
  3. Transfer the mixture to a greased casserole dish and sprinkle the remaining cheese on top. Finish with breadcrumbs for a crunchy topping.
  4. Bake for 30-35 minutes until bubbly and golden on top.

1. Chicken Tikka Masala

Bring the taste of India to your dining table with this flavorful curry dish.

Ingredients:

  • 1 lb boneless chicken breast, cubed
  • 1 cup plain yogurt
  • 2 tablespoons garam masala
  • 1 can coconut milk
  • 1 onion, finely ch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on ginger, minced
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Cooked rice for serving

Instructions:

  1. Marinate the chicken cubes in yogurt and garam masala for at least 1 hour (or overnight for best results).
  2. In a large skillet, heat oil over medium heat and sauté onions, garlic, and ginger until fragrant.
  3. Add the marinated chicken and cook until browned.
  4. Pour in the coconut milk, season with salt and pepper, and simmer for 20 minutes. Serve hot with cooked rice.

2. Chicken Adobo

This traditional Filipino dish is a must-try, known for its bold flavors and simplicity.

Ingredients:

  • 1 lb chicken thighs
  • ½ cup soy sauce
  • ½ cup vinegar
  • 4 cloves garlic, crushed
  • 2 bay leaves
  • 1 teaspoon peppercorns

Instructions:

  1. In a large pot, combine the soy sauce, vinegar, garlic, bay leaves, and peppercorns. Add the chicken and marinate for at least 30 minutes.
  2. Bring the mixture to a simmer over medium heat. Cover and cook for about 30 minutes or until the chicken is tender.
  3. Serve with steamed rice to soak up the delicious sauce.

What are some easy chicken dishes I can prepare for supper?

Preparing easy chicken dishes for supper can be a breeze with just a few simple recipes. One popular option is chicken stir-fry, where you can quickly cook bite-sized pieces of chicken breast with a variety of vegetables. Just toss everything together in a hot skillet with your favorite sauces for a delicious meal that can be ready in 30 minutes.

Another fantastic choice is baked chicken thighs, which can be seasoned to your taste. Just marinate the thighs in olive oil, garlic, and herbs, and let them bake in the oven. This method not only locks in moisture but also allows for easy cleanup, making it perfect for a relaxing supper.

How can I make my chicken dishes more flavorful?

Improving the flavor of your chicken dishes can be achieved through various methods. First, marinating your chicken for a few hours before cooking can enhance its taste. Use a mix of acidic ingredients like lemon juice or vinegar with herbs and spices to create a marinade that penetrates the meat, making it tender and flavorful.

Another strategy is to use aromatics such as garlic, onions, or ginger, which can be sautéed before adding the chicken. Additionally, experimenting with different spice blends or sauces can elevate your dish significantly. Don’t shy away from trying international cuisines that embrace bold flavors; this can introduce exciting twists to your traditional chicken recipes.

Can I prepare chicken dishes ahead of time?

Absolutely! Preparing chicken dishes ahead of time can save you time and effort during busy weeknights. You can marinate the chicken a day in advance and store it in the refrigerator. This allows the flavors to meld beautifully and can make your average meal feel gourmet. You can also prep vegetables and any grains you’ll serve alongside, which will streamline the cooking process.

Another great option is to cook chicken in batches and then refrigerate or freeze the leftovers. Dishes like shredded chicken can be easily stored and incorporated into other meals throughout the week, such as tacos, salads, or sandwiches. This not only minimizes waste but also gives you versatile, ready-to-use protein options on hand.

What sides pair well with chicken dishes?

When it comes to sides, chicken is incredibly versatile and can be complemented by a variety of accompaniments. Classic choices include roasted vegetables, like broccoli, carrots, or Brussels sprouts, which bring a nutritious element to your meal. These can be seasoned and cooked alongside your chicken for a cohesive flavor profile.

For a heartier option, consider serving the chicken with rice or quinoa. These grains can act as a fantastic base to absorb delicious sauces from your chicken dish. Additionally, salads are a fresh and light complement, especially when topped with nuts or a zesty dressing for added texture and flavor.

Are there healthy chicken recipes for supper?

Yes, there are numerous healthy chicken recipes that can be perfect for supper! One option is grilled chicken with a side of steamed vegetables, which provides a lean protein source while keeping calories low. You can marinate the chicken in a mixture of olive oil, lemon juice, and herbs for flavor without adding excessive fat.

Another nutritious choice is to prepare chicken soup, rich in vegetables and broth. This dish can be both comforting and packed with nutrients, particularly if you include plenty of seasonal veggies and whole grains like brown rice or barley. This way, you not only enjoy a hearty meal but also benefit from its health advantages.

What cooking methods work best for chicken dishes?

There are several cooking methods you can use for chicken dishes, each providing unique flavors and textures. Baking is a fantastic option, as it allows for a crispy exterior while keeping the inside juicy. This method works well for cuts like thighs, drums, or whole chicken, especially when seasoned properly.

Another popular method is sautéing or stir-frying, which is ideal for quick weeknight meals. This technique involves cooking bite-sized pieces of chicken over high heat, which can lock in flavor and provide a wonderful texture. Additionally, slow cooking is excellent for developing rich flavors and tender meat, making it suitable for soups and stews. Each of these methods can be easily tailored to match your style and flavor preferences.
